News

Use PyInstaller to package your Python apps into standalone executables for easy distribution.
Python dataclasses can make your Python classes less verbose and more powerful at the same time. Here's an introduction to using dataclasses in your Python programs.
I recently facilitated two workshops for high school teachers to introduce them to python in physics. Here are my lessons learned.